Diabetic kidney disease (DKD) is the leading cause of end-stage renal disease worldwide. Reninangiotensin system (RAS) inhibitors are the first-line treatment for diabetic patients with hypertension. However, whether RAS inhibitors prevent the development of DKD remains controversial. | Does antihypertensive treatment with renin-angiotensin system inhibitors prevent the development of diabetic kidney disease?
